Output d2afa1750ab2369319b3811744063e7a5227ac797dbf0796e542c64729d0aa8b:2

value
38959390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ebf8160ce39450e8169a0ec008cb3a00ffa50d OP_EQUAL
address
MS2xhqDfuXGvBWynXTCQYFmH16bUo8idov
transaction
d2afa1750ab2369319b3811744063e7a5227ac797dbf0796e542c64729d0aa8b
spent
true